Handmade Pottery Jars

Handmade pottery jars influenced by traditional Japanese ceramics as well as western forms and functions. Most are unglazed, wood-fired, with the only decoration being the natural wood ash and fire marks. Some smaller ones are glazed, such as those for tableware and some water jars for tea ceremony. Large jars are wonderful for ikebana flower arrangement.
